In phlebotomy training, students are educated more than just knowing where to place the needle when drawing blood. On the job phlebotomy training in Wilmington Delaware comprises supervised practical experience drawing blood, disposing of biohazardous materials, and basic laboratory processes. Hands-on phlebotomy training is, in addition, intensely safety-centered, since workers risk frequent exposure to blood-borne illnesses--including Hepatitis and HIV. These instruments comprise various sized syringes, biohazardous-spill kits, tourniquets, dermal puncture devices, blood culture bottles, locking arm rests, bandages and tape.

You need to make sure of collecting blood samples carefully and then labeling and cataloging them professionally as well. Writing accurately plays just an important role here-if a sample isn't labeled properly, the patient could be misdiagnosed and treated with the wrong medications. Thus, as part of your phlebotomy training, you must learn to pay attention to such details.
